The electromagnetic transients program emtp dates back to 1960s development by hermann dommel, first in germany, then at bpa emtp and has become and industry standard verified models.

The simulation of electromagnetic transients is a mature field that plays an important role in the design of modern power systems. Examples of this alternate stream include rtds technologies, pscademtdc, emtp rv, mt emtp, emtp atp, emegasim and hypersim from opalrt technologies. The paper investigates the applicability of some closed form expressions for the ground impedance and ground admittance of buried horizontal wires bare and insulated for lightning or switching transient analyses based on transmission line tl theory.
